Eight Vietnamese children won prizes at the 31st Lidice Rose international painting contest, in the Czech Republic.



Lam Dieu Linh, 8, was awarded a medal, and seven others received certificates of merit at a ceremony held in Hanoi on May 20 by the Czech Embassy.



Lidice Rose is held annually in the Czech Republic for children at the age of 4-16, and is dedicated to the memory of the children of Lidice Village murdered during World War II.



The contest this year drew entries from children in over 60 countries. Vietnamese children have entered the contest many times, often collecting prizes.
